The "Other" Bird wins it. Summer Bird that is.

Link to the video here-http://www.ntra.com/video.aspx?id=39773



What a race! I thought Dunkirk had it untill I saw Summer Bird come up on the outside and go by him and Mine that Bird effortlessly. I wasn't surprised with this win as I had kept my eye on him but not so much as to pick him to win. I thought he would at least place fourth or fifth but not win. The other Bird won't be called the other Bird now I'm guessing.


It's too bad about Dunkirk though. Yesterday they found he had a non-displaced condylar fracture. Makes you think if maybe he hadn't hurt himself during the race maybe he could have fought Summer Bird off and won. Probably by the skin of his teeth though because Summer Bird was flying. Congrats to Tim Ice on his birthday Belmont win!
I also wasn't surprised Mine that Bird didn't do so well. It wasn't only Calvin Borel moving too early on him though. It was him being so wound up come race day. He was prancing and bucking and full of it coming to the paddock. Meanwhile at the Derby walkover he was as calm as a cucumber. I knew from that moment he wasn't going to turn in his best race.
